2010 Saab 03-Sep vs. 2010 Ascari A10

To start off, both 2010 Saab 03-Sep and 2010 Ascari A10 were released in the same year (2010).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 4,941 cc (8 cylinders), 2010 Ascari A10 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2010 Ascari A10 (625 HP @ 7500 RPM) has 418 more horse power than 2010 Saab 03-Sep. (207 HP @ 5300 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2010 Ascari A10 should accelerate faster than 2010 Saab 03-Sep.

Because 2010 Ascari A10 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2010 Ascari A10.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2010 Saab 03-Sep,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2010 Ascari A10 (560 Nm @ 5500 RPM) has 261 more torque (in Nm) than 2010 Saab 03-Sep. (299 Nm @ 2500 RPM). This means 2010 Ascari A10 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2010 Saab 03-Sep.
